Technical Specifications
This construction locknut accommodates 3-1/2" trade size rigid steel conduit and IMC (Intermediate Metal Conduit) with standard NPT threading. The zinc-plated steel construction provides superior corrosion resistance compared to uncoated alternatives. Compact dimensions of 4.05" length x 2.43" width x 1.33" height with lightweight 0.18 lb design minimize space requirements while maintaining full mechanical strength. The thin profile construction allows for use in applications where standard locknuts may not fit due to space constraints.
Installation Process
- Verify conduit end is properly reamed and deburred to prevent thread damage
- Thread conduit through enclosure knockout or hub opening to desired position
- Slide locknut onto conduit threads from inside of enclosure
- Hand-tighten locknut against enclosure wall to establish initial contact
- Use appropriate wrench or locknut tool to tighten securely, ensuring proper grounding contact
- Verify locknut is fully seated and conduit is properly secured without over-tightening
